Philadelphia Magazine ( @phillymag / @phillymagevents ) is hosting its second annual Food & Dine on Thursday, February 20th at Ensemble Arts Philly – Kimmel Center at 300 South Broad Street. Guests will enjoy tasting more than 400 premium wines from around the world paired with samples of dishes offered from a variety of Philadelphia’s top restaurants served in an upscale, festival environment.

This event joins Philadelphia Magazine’s Wine Festival along with Foobooz’ Philly Cooks together in one night, with top local restaurants hand-selected by Philadelphia magazine’s editors, as well as others highlighted on the magazine’s 50 Best Restaurants list.

The events takes place from 6 to 9 p.m. for general admission ticket holders, with VIP ticket holders entering at 5 p.m. VIP benefits include early access to the event while receiving a more intimate experience with the winemakers and chefs, the ability to taste of a selection of rare wines not offered during general admission, the chance to be amongst the first to sample dishes from top local chefs and restaurants, and access to the private VIP Lounge featuring premium samplings and an exclusive chef’s tasting experience.
